In the world of the Solana cryptocurrency network, a fierce battle is brewing between major participants, leading to serious disruptions in transactions for ordinary users. A Duo Nine cryptanalyst warns that competitors are launching massive DDoS attacks on each other, jeopardizing the ability to conduct transactions on the Solana network.
The result of this struggle has been a congested block space, which has resulted in regular users being unable to conduct their transactions due to lack of block space.
Threat of large-scale disruptions
The analyst warns that such delays could cause widespread disruption to Solana's network. Users are starting to lose trust in this cryptocurrency platform, and if the situation does not change, many of them may switch to alternative networks.
Attacks on wallets and security
Duo Nine discovered that even Solana wallets were being attacked as a result of this struggle. Bots target them, filling them with spam and preventing users from transacting.
Victims of attacks are forced to create new wallets, but this does not solve the problem, since new addresses are also at risk of attack. A solution to the problem has still not been found, and while the Solana team promises to resolve the transaction issues soon, the public is left waiting.
